REAR WINDOW DEFOGGER SYSTEM


System Description


Operation Description
- Turn rear window defogger switch ON when the ignition switch is turned ON. Then multifunction switch (rear window defogger switch) transmits rear window defogger switch signal to AV control unit via AV communication. AV control unit transmits rear window defogger switch signal to BCM via CAN communication.
- BCM turns rear window defogger relay ON and transmit rear window defogger ON signal to IPDM E/R via CAN communication when rear window defogger switch signal is received.
- Door mirror defogger (with mirror defogger) are supplied with power and operate when rear window defogger relay turns ON.
- Rear window defogger relay sends power supply to retractable hard top control unit.
- Retractable hard top control unit detects roof state and controls rear window defogger operate.
- AV control unit transmit rear window defogger control signal to multifunction switch (rear window defogger switch) via AV communication.
- IPDM E/R transmits rear window defogger control signal to AV control unit via CAN communication.

Timer function
- BCM turns rear window defogger relay ON for approximately 15 minutes when rear window defogger switch is turned ON. It makes rear window defogger and door mirror defogger (with mirror defogger) operate.
- Timer is canceled after pressing rear window defogger switch again during timer operation. Then BCM turns rear window defogger relay OFF. The same reaction also occurs during timer operation, if the ignition switch is turned OFF.
